Buffalo Tungsten is a leading manufacturer and global supplier of high purity tungsten powder. We have a strong commitment to quality assurance, competitive pricing, and short lead times. Because of our rigorous quality assurance system, the powders we produce meet the highest standards of purity and consistency. We have over three decades of experience and maintain a sole focus on producing powdered tungsten materials through a hydrogen reduction process. We have supplied customers in over 40 countries throughout the world. In addition to pure tungsten powder, we also produce tungsten carbide powder and tungsten carbide based thermal spray powders. Buffalo Tungsten is part of Sandvik group and organizationally belongs to the Powder Solutions division within the business area Sandvik Machining.
KEY PERFORMANCE AREAS
The Manufacturing Planner's role includes creating production schedules and organizing workflows within departments, ensuring each operation is sequenced and timed appropriately. Ensure efficient and accurate accounting and storage of raw material, work in progress, and finished goods.
Key Responsibilities
Always adheres to established safety policies and procedures
Model effective leadership, teamwork, and collaboration in a fair and transparent way
Plan, schedule and coordinate production of products according to customer specifications
Work closely with Production Manager to plan resources and jobs efficiently
Monitor and expedite operations that can delay production schedules
Alter production schedules and plans as needed to maintain efficiency and quality
Evaluate raw materials and needed equipment to ensure all required inputs are available
Report on production status and/or issues to Planning Manager
Identify methods and processes to improve production efficiency/productivity
Coordinates and follows up on manufacturing workflows
Store items received in appropriate storage areas, documenting any changes
Maintain accurate and efficient inventory management practices for raw materials, finished goods, and constituents and report to Business Controlling
Identify and resolve inventory discrepancies as they arise
Support business controlling with monthly inventory reconciliation
Perform other duties as assigned by the Manager.
